Election symbols allocated to 20 parties for by-election



KATHMANDU: The Election Commission (EC) has allocated election symbols to 20 political parties gearing up for the forthcoming by-election in Illam and Bajhang districts.

The by-election for a House of Representatives (HoR) seat in Illam-2 and a Provincial Assembly seat in Bajhang-1 is slated for April 27.

In Illam district, 20 parties are vying for participation in the by-election, while in Bajhang, 19 parties are in the fray.

The allocation of election symbols marks a significant step in the electoral process, facilitating the identification of parties and candidates for voters ahead of the polls.
